Output 003cc1428934528b1d45652a3c8e2aadffac9684be8c7e9940e53926131af0b3:18

value
53679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ff5514e2055eed81c47471de57b4253a7750bed OP_EQUAL
address
3DMbcsWtP9kLQYAgp9xKSX7icxq1ujvaBL
transaction
003cc1428934528b1d45652a3c8e2aadffac9684be8c7e9940e53926131af0b3
spent
true